What is Dutasteride?

Dutasteride is a synthetic steroid compound that is approved for the treatment of benign prostatic hyperplasia.1, 2 It is considered an improved version of its predecessor, finasteride, and is used off-label to treat hair loss. 

Dutasteride works by blocking production of the enzyme 5α-reductase, which is responsible for converting testosterone into dihydrotestosterone (DHT).3 In the context of hair loss, DHT compromises the growth phase of the hair cycle, leading to follicular miniaturisation. The end result is the progressive formation of shorter, finer hairs leading to hair loss.

5α-reductase exists as different subtypes (Types 1-3) that all perform the same function but differ in terms of their distribution in human tissue and levels of expression at various stages of development.4  Dutasteride inhibits the Type 1 and Type 2 forms of 5α-reductase whereas finasteride inhibits only the Type 2 form.

Several studies evaluating the efficacy of oral dutasteride5 to treat androgenetic alopecia (male pattern hair loss), with comparison6, 7, 8 to oral finasteride suggest that dutasteride provides superior results to finasteride, although patient response can vary between individuals.

Despite dutasteride not being approved for the treatment of hair loss, it is commonly used off-label for this purpose. Not surprisingly, there are also no approved versions of topical dutasteride, although several online entities appear to offer it, usually in conjunction with a prescription.
